Corsair’s Vengeance RGB DDR5 reminiscence kits sit between the tasteless gray modules of its customary Vengeance kits and the super-fancy modules on its Dominator modules. They’re quick and (due to a big value drop since our unique overview) well-priced too, and Corsair can be now producing AMD EXPO fashions for the newest AMD Zen 4 programs.

The candy spot is a 6000MHz frequency with tight 30-36-36-76 timings, and the modules are significantly shorter than DDR4 Vengeance RGB Professional DIMMs too, measuring simply 45mm tall. For lighting, you get ten individually managed RGB LEDs sitting beneath a diffusing mild bar. The colours are extra vivid than these on the unique Vengeance RGB Professional DDR4 modules, however they don’t seem to be as vibrant.

As an added bonus, you get two EXPO profiles on a 6000MHz package, with a 6200MHz possibility along with the usual 6000MHz profile.

This speedy Kingston Fury Renegade DDR5 RGB package sits on the prime of the corporate’s vary and has the appears to be like, frequency, timings and value to match. The 6400MHz package we examined makes use of critically quick SK Hynix reminiscence chips and has very tight latency timings of 32-39-39-80. In our AIDA64 Excessive learn and write exams, this package topped our graphs, with a 94GB/s learn pace, 87GB/s write pace and 63.5nm latency.

The heatsink design may be very enticing, with one black layer sitting on the reminiscence chips and a silver shroud sitting on prime of this layer. The heatsinks did a good job of cooling the reminiscence as properly, and the RGB lighting is especially vibrant and vivid.

Whereas you need to use ASRock, Asus, Gigabyte, or MSI’s software program to manage the lighting, there’s additionally Kingston’s Fury CTRL software program, which gives detailed management over colours and results for every LED on every module.

Gaming RAM FAQ

What do RAM numbers imply?

The lengthy sequence of numbers used to determine reminiscence specs is almightily complicated, significantly once you’re searching an etailer retailer on-line. As an alternative of simply DDR4 3200MHz, you will usually see a sequence of letters and numbers reminiscent of PC4-25600C16, presumably adopted by a string of hyphenated numbers, reminiscent of 16-20-20-49. What does this all imply?

The primary half is simply the kind of reminiscence. So, PC4 is DDR4, PC5 is DDR5, and so forth. The second lengthy quantity is the pace in MB/s, which within the case of DDR4 and DDR5 is calculated both by taking the efficient clock pace and multiplying it by eight, So, for a 3200MHz (efficient) reminiscence module, its MB/sec score is 8 x 3,200, which equals 25,600MB/sec, ending up with a PC4-25600 label.

The ultimate piece of the puzzle is the C16 quantity (or equal) on the top, which refers back to the column handle strobe (CAS) latency (CL) of the reminiscence. This is among the generally offered measures of the latency in clock cycles that it takes for a reminiscence module to answer a command. CL can be the primary of the 4 hyphenated numbers you will see on reminiscence listings, with the opposite three being row handle strobe (RAS) to CAS delay (tRCD), row precharge time (tRP), and row lively time (rRAS).

These phrases all refer again to the grid construction used to assemble the RAM. As a result of the reminiscence cells are accessed first by a row being activated, then the columns from that row being accessed, there are inherent delays related to every step of this course of. As such, CAS latency is the delay in knowledge beginning to arrive again from the reminiscence after a learn command has been despatched, however solely as soon as the row for that set of columns has already been activated.

In the meantime, tRCD is the time between opening (activating) a row of reminiscence and accessing the columns inside it – so the overall time to entry a column on a non-active row is CL+ tRCD. Subsequent up is tRP, which is the time required to precharge the present row (the method required to deactivate the present row) and open the following row. That offers us a system for the overall time to entry knowledge from DRAM when the fallacious row is presently open to be CL+tRCD+tRP. Lastly, we’ve got tRAS, which is the minimal time wanted to maintain a row open to permit knowledge to be learn or written correctly.

The decrease these numbers, the decrease the general latency of the reminiscence. Latency timings have steadily elevated with every era of DDR, however their affect has been completely outweighed by the advances in clock pace. As an example, a CL18 3200MHz DDR4 module could have a latency of 18 x 2,000 / 3,200 = 11.3ns (nanoseconds), whereas a CL32 6400MHz DDR5 module with could have an efficient latency of 32 x 2,000 / 6,400 = 10ns.

There is a last quantity you would possibly see on some reminiscence listings and in motherboard BIOS settings as properly, which is the command fee. Usually, it will likely be both 1T or 2T and this refers back to the variety of clock cycles between a DRAM chip being chosen and a command being executed. Utilizing 1T is quicker however 2T could be extra steady.

Do RAM latency timings matter for gaming?

In our exams, latency timings have a negligible affect on gaming efficiency. To place this to the take a look at, we coupled an Intel Core i5-12600K with 32GB of Kingston Fury Renegade 6400MHz reminiscence and a GTX 1060 graphics card, we recorded only a 0.5fps rise within the minimal body fee and a 0.1fps rise within the common body fee in our Cyberpunk 2077 benchmark when going from timings of 32-38-38-80 to 42-50-50-80.

Given the big distinction in these timings and the microscopic distinction in body fee, it is clear that latency timings are largely irrelevant for gaming. Nonetheless, latency timings do affect efficiency in Home windows when multi-tasking, by a median of 5 % in our exams.

Does RAM clock pace matter for gaming?

Whereas reminiscence timings might need a delicate impact on system efficiency, the affect of reminiscence clock pace is extra noticeable. Utilizing the identical take a look at package as for latency timing, we underclocked our DDR5 RAM package to 3200MHz (efficient) then 4800MHz and in contrast the outcomes to the efficiency on the package’s default 6400MHz pace.

Throughout the board, we noticed notable efficiency variations, most seen in our heavy multi-tasking workload the place the default 6400MHz pace reminiscence knock over ten seconds off the 3200MHz consequence – a 32 % distinction.

In single-threaded workloads, the distinction wasn’t fairly so dramatic however even in video games we noticed our Cyberpunk 2077 common body fee rise from 38.6fps to 39.2fps whereas the minimal body fee rose from 26.7fps to 27.4fps.

Total, although, each the tiny distinction in system efficiency when various reminiscence timings, and the extra noticeable however nonetheless comparatively small variations when various reminiscence clock pace, communicate to the actual function of reminiscence in PC efficiency gaming. When all is claimed and achieved, reminiscence would not present the processing pace that makes a PC run quick – it simply ensures the processors aren’t starved of knowledge on which to work.

AMD or Intel optimized RAM?

Some DDR4 kits are offered as ‘Intel optimized’ or ‘AMD optimized’, which made sense just a few years in the past. When the first-generation AMD Ryzen programs had been launched, we noticed a lot of reminiscence refusing to POST at frequencies past 2933MHz, even when they had been rated a lot increased.

This downside was quickly solved by kits primarily based on Samsung’s B-die reminiscence, which might POST at their full rated frequencies. Nonetheless, with the newest DDR4 programs we have seen little tangible distinction between ‘Intel optimized’ and ‘AMD optimized’ reminiscence. We have additionally seen some ‘AMD optimized’ reminiscence fail to hit its top-rated frequency in Socket AM4 motherboards, whereas it is effective in Intel programs – you largely needn’t fear about this with DDR4 reminiscence now.

With DDR5 reminiscence, AMD has launched its EXPO profile system, which is analogous to Intel’s XMP system. Your motherboard ought to detect its most rated frequency, latency timings, and voltage routinely, and allow you to apply it simply. In our personal AMD Expo benchmarks, we have additionally seen EXPO reminiscence carry out higher on AMD Zen 4 programs than non-EXPO reminiscence. Equally, for Intel programs, you need reminiscence that helps Intel’s newest XMP 3 reminiscence profile system.
